微前端VUE页面加载过慢
时间: 2023-06-01 16:06:35 浏览: 209
对于微前端VUE页面加载过慢的问题,可能是由于页面中的资源过多或者加载的资源较大导致的。可以尝试优化资源加载的方式,比如使用CDN加速、压缩资源等方式来提升页面加载速度。另外,也可以考虑使用懒加载等技术,将页面中不必要的资源延迟加载或异步加载,以提高页面的响应速度。
相关问题
vue解决页面加载过慢
页面加载过慢可能是由于以下原因导致的:
1. 图片过多或过大,导致页面加载缓慢;
2. 代码未压缩或合并,导致文件大小过大,加载速度变慢;
3. 后端数据返回过慢,导致页面渲染缓慢;
4. 使用了复杂的 CSS 或 JS 动画效果,导致页面渲染缓慢;
5. 网络延迟或带宽不足。
针对以上问题,可以采取以下措施来优化页面加载速度:
1. 对图片进行压缩,尽量避免使用过多或过大的图片;
2. 对代码进行压缩和合并,减少文件大小;
3. 使用缓存技术,如 CDN、浏览器缓存等,加快页面加载速度;
4. 对后端接口进行优化,减少请求次数和请求数据量;
5. 减少使用复杂的 CSS 或 JS 动画效果,或者使用 CSS3 动画代替 JS 动画;
6. 使用懒加载技术,只加载当前可见区域的内容,避免一次性加载过多内容;
7. 使用 Webpack 等构建工具进行代码打包和优化,减少文件大小和加载时间。
以上措施可以帮助优化页面加载速度,提升用户体验。
vue页面加载太慢卡顿
如果 Vue 页面加载过慢,可能会出现卡顿的情况。这可能是由于以下原因导致的:
1. 大量的静态资源:过多的图片、CSS、JS文件会增加页面加载时间,导致页面加载缓慢。
2. 组件渲染太多:页面中可能存在大量的组件,如果组件嵌套层数过多,或者组件本身复杂度较高,都会导致页面加载速度变慢。
3. 数据加载过多:如果页面中需要加载大量数据,也会影响页面加载速度。
针对这些问题,我们可以采取以下措施:
1. 压缩静态资源:可以通过压缩图片大小、合并 CSS 和 JS 文件等方式来减少静态资源的数量,从而提高页面加载速度。
2. 优化组件渲染:可以通过尽可能减少组件的嵌套层数、使用 keep-alive 缓存组件等方式来提高组件渲染效率。
3. 使用懒加载:可以将页面中不需要立即加载的数据或组件使用懒加载的方式来提高页面加载速度。